AI Investments Must Be Strategic, Not Trend-Driven
Many companies rush to adopt AI without a clear investment strategy. They experiment with chatbots, automation, or predictive analytics—but without a defined roadmap, AI initiatives often fail to scale.
Successful AI investment isn’t about buying the latest tools—it’s about aligning AI with business goals, measuring impact, and ensuring scalability.
Where Should Leaders Invest in AI?
1️⃣ AI for Operational Efficiency
AI-powered automation can significantly cut costs and increase productivity. Businesses investing in AI-driven workflows, robotic process automation (RPA), and predictive maintenance see quick efficiency gains.
✅ Best AI Applications:
Supply Chain Optimization – AI predicts demand, minimizes waste, and enhances logistics.
Process Automation – Reduces manual tasks, saving time and resources.
Predictive Maintenance – AI-driven sensors prevent costly machine failures.
2️⃣ AI for Customer Experience & Personalization
Customer expectations are higher than ever. AI enhances customer interactions, personalizes services, and improves engagement.
✅ Best AI Applications:
AI Chatbots & Virtual Assistants – Improve customer service efficiency.
Personalized Marketing – AI-driven recommendations increase conversion rates.
Sentiment Analysis – Understand customer emotions and improve retention.
3️⃣ AI for Decision-Making & Analytics
AI transforms raw data into actionable insights, enabling better business decisions. Companies investing in AI-powered business intelligence, predictive analytics, and real-time data processing gain a competitive edge.
✅ Best AI Applications:
AI-Powered BI Tools – Improve decision-making with data-driven insights.
Predictive Analytics – Identify trends and mitigate business risks.
Real-Time Data Processing – Enables faster, more informed leadership decisions.
4️⃣ AI for Talent & Workforce Transformation
The future of work is AI-driven. Companies investing in AI-driven HR tools, employee upskilling, and workforce analytics will be better prepared for AI’s impact on job roles.
✅ Best AI Applications:
AI-Powered Hiring & Recruitment – Identifies top talent efficiently.
Workforce Analytics – Optimizes HR strategies using AI-driven insights.
AI Upskilling Programs – Prepares employees for AI-integrated roles.
5️⃣ AI for Innovation & Competitive Advantage
AI can create entirely new revenue streams by enabling new business models, improving R&D, and driving product innovation.
✅ Best AI Applications:
AI in Product Development – Accelerates innovation cycles.
Generative AI for Content & Design – Automates creative processes.
AI-Driven R&D – Enhances scientific discovery and experimentation.
The Role of Leadership in AI Investment Strategy
💡 AI investment is a leadership decision, not just an IT expense.
Executives must prioritize AI projects that align with long-term business goals.
Measuring AI ROI is key—track efficiency, revenue growth, and customer satisfaction.
A successful AI investment strategy balances quick wins with scalable, future-proof solutions.
